Look for and purchase products that are made from post-consumer content (materials have been collected back from previous products and remade into new ones) such as paper and plastic products. Even paper clips with post-consumer metals content are now available.

Don’t leave your office lights on overnight.

Replace standard incandescent bulbs with compact fluorescent lamps wherever possible.
